RobLawMax Recruitment - Christchurch, South Island

RobLawMax Recruitment has been appointed exclusively to recruit a Senior Mechanical Project Engineer for an established Canterbury mechanical engineering business.

The company provides end-to-end engineering services across the dairy, food processing, energy and wider industrial sectors. Its work spans process and thermal plant, boilers and pressure equipment, piping systems, material handling equipment, structural steelwork and complex mechanical upgrades.

Early contractor involvement is underway on a major industrial design-and-build project. High-level design and pricing have commenced, with detailed design, procurement and delivery expected to follow later this year. The initial programme will run through to 2028, with further opportunities expected to provide an ongoing pipeline of complex industrial work.

The business is now seeking an experienced mechanical Project Engineer who can take a leading role in the delivery of this programme.

The role

This is a broad project leadership position combining engineering, commercial and delivery responsibility.

Working alongside an established engineering, project and workshop team, you will help drive the project from early design through procurement, fabrication, installation and commissioning.

You will:

  • Take ownership of engineering and project delivery across a major industrial design-and-build project
  • Establish and manage project programmes, budgets, deliverables and reporting requirements
  • Coordinate mechanical design and technical inputs across internal engineers, clients, suppliers and specialist consultants
  • Manage project scope, programme, cost, risk, quality and commercial performance
  • Act as a key interface with the client and maintain alignment across project stakeholders
  • Review concepts, calculations, 3D models, drawings, specifications and technical documentation
  • Ensure engineering solutions are safe, practical, buildable and aligned with project requirements
  • Prepare and manage procurement packages, supplier specifications and subcontracted scopes of work
  • Coordinate equipment selection, procurement and long-lead items
  • Work closely with fabrication, construction and site teams
  • Manage technical queries, design changes and project variations
  • Support installation, testing, commissioning and final handover
  • Contribute to the development of project systems, engineering processes and internal capability

While this is primarily a project leadership role, you will need strong mechanical design understanding and the ability to remain technically involved when required. You won't necessarily produce every model or drawing yourself, but you must be able to guide, challenge and review the engineering work being delivered.
